Abstract:

The notion of multiple representations of a system model is becoming more popular, and is a significant motivation behind the drive to integrate system development methods. Some metaCASE tools claim to allow method integration, but typically still make assumptions that impose constraints on the methods integrated, and the way they are integrated. This paper describes a prototype environment for multiple representations, based on a four-level approach to modelling system development knowledge, and that supports several complementary integration mechanisms. 1.
